程序员零基础做什么好

时间:2025-01-24 19:34:33 手机游戏

对于零基础想要进入程序员行业的求职者,以下是一些建议:

Web开发

学习内容:HTML、CSS、JavaScript,以及可选的后端技术如PHP、Node.js等。

入门难度:相对较低,容易上手。

兼职机会:可以通过搭建个人网站、参与开源项目或为企业做技术支持来赚取外快。

移动应用开发

学习内容:Java或Kotlin(Android开发)、Swift(iOS开发)。

入门难度:相对较高,需要一定时间学习。

兼职机会:可以开发简单的应用并发布到应用商店,或者参与团队开发项目。

数据分析

学习内容:Python、R语言,以及数据处理和统计分析工具。

入门难度:中等,需要掌握一定的数据处理知识。

兼职机会:可以为企业提供数据清洗、分析和可视化服务。

自动化脚本编写

学习内容:Python、Shell脚本等。

入门难度:较低,适合初学者快速掌握。

兼职机会:可以编写自动化脚本来简化企业中的重复任务。

网络安全

学习内容:网络安全知识、渗透测试、漏洞分析等。

入门难度:较高,需要系统学习和实践。

兼职机会:可以为企业提供网络安全评估和保护服务。

实习或兼职工作

学习内容:在实际项目中应用所学知识,提升实践能力。

入门难度:根据具体项目和公司不同而有所差异。

兼职机会:许多公司会招聘编程实习生或兼职程序员,这是一个很好的学习和成长机会。

网络平台工作

学习内容:根据平台要求学习相关技能,如前端开发、后端开发、数据分析等。

入门难度:根据具体平台和项目不同而有所差异。

兼职机会:可以在Freelancer、Upwork等平台上接受小型项目。

建议

选择方向:根据个人兴趣和长期职业规划选择合适的方向进行深入学习。

注重实践:在学习理论知识的同时,多进行实际项目练习,提升实践能力。

建立网络:多参加技术社区和论坛,与其他开发者建立联系,获取兼职机会和信息。

持续学习:技术更新迅速,要保持持续学习的态度,不断提升自己的技能水平。

通过以上建议,零基础的学习者可以逐步进入程序员行业,并找到适合自己的兼职工作。